Adicet Bio, Inc., a clinical-stage biotechnology firm, reported a net loss of $116.8 million for the year ended December 31, 2025, compared to a net loss of $117.1 million for the previous year. Research and development expenses totaled $99.1 million, slightly down from $99.3 million in 2024, primarily due to decreased payroll and lab supply costs, offset by increased contracted research expenses. General and administrative expenses decreased by 19% to $23.0 million, mainly driven by lower stock-based compensation and reduced rent and office-related expenses.

The company's revenue stream remains non-existent, as it has no products approved for commercial sale. Interest income decreased significantly, falling 46% to $5.8 million, attributed to lower interest rates and reduced cash balances. Other expenses, net, increased by 98% to $0.4 million, primarily due to losses on the disposal of assets. As of December 31, 2025, Adicet Bio held $158.5 million in cash, cash equivalents, and short-term investments.

Operationally, Adicet Bio is focusing on advancing its pipeline of allogeneic gamma delta T cell therapies. Its lead product candidate, prula-cel, is currently in Phase 1 clinical trials for various autoimmune diseases, including lupus nephritis, systemic lupus erythematosus, and systemic sclerosis. The company expects to provide clinical updates on these trials in the first half of 2026. ADI-212, a next-generation candidate targeting prostate-specific membrane antigen, is slated for a regulatory filing in the third quarter of 2026, with patient enrollment expected to begin in the fourth quarter of the same year.

Adicet Bio discontinued the development of ADI-270 to prioritize resources on prula-cel and ADI-212. The company believes its current cash position will sustain operations into the second half of 2027. However, future success depends on clinical trial outcomes, regulatory approvals, and the ability to secure additional funding, which may be affected by unstable market conditions. The company had 102 full-time employees as of December 31, 2025.

About Adicet Bio, Inc.

Adicet Bio, Inc. is a clinical-stage biotechnology company developing allogeneic "off-the-shelf" gamma delta T cell therapies engineered with ch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) for autoimmune diseases and cancer. Its pipeline includes product candidates targeting B cell-mediated autoimmune disorders and CD70+ solid tumors. Adicet’s proprietary platform enables scalable manufacturing from unrelated donors, offering potential advantages in safety, tissue targeting, and cost-efficiency over autologous and other cell therapies.

About 10-K Filings

A 10-K form is a comprehensive annual report that public companies in the United States must file with the SEC, providing a detailed overview of the company's financial condition, performance, and business strategies.

Key points about the 10-K:

  • Frequency: Filed annually, typically within 60 to 90 days after the end of the company's fiscal year.
  • Content: It includes:
    • Detailed financial statements audited by an independent accounting firm
    • Management's Discussion and Analysis (MD&A) of financial condition and results
    • Description of the company's business, properties, and legal proceedings
    • Risk factors and market risks
    • Executive compensation and corporate governance information
  • Importance: Considered the most comprehensive and important document a public company files with the SEC.
  • Length: Often exceeds 100 pages due to its extensive and detailed nature.
